Frequently Asked Questions

Where do you meet students?

All appointments are in-person and take place at my Whitefish Bay office on Silver Spring Drive in the Fox Bay/ Argo building. It’s the same building as the Whitefish Bay Starbucks. My tutoring location is easily accessible for those in the Milwaukee Northshore area. Parking is abundant for students who drive

What schools do you work with most often?

Most tutoring students come from the schools close to Whitefish Bay. In addition to Whitefish Bay High School, students may come from private schools such as Marquette High School, Dominican, DSHA, University School of Milwaukee, and nearby public schools – Shorewood, Nicolet, Homestead. In addition, it is common for me to tutor students from Wauwatosa, Brookfield, Hartland, and Milwaukee Public Schools, among others.

What are your tutoring hours?

Late afternoon and evenings Sunday through Thursday. Starting around 3pm until 9:30 is convenient for nearby students from Whitefish Bay, Shorewood, Mequon Homestead, Nicolet High School to get to tutoring. In the summer, I tutor those same hours, so that students can get tutoring for the ACT, or math and science subjects such as Geometry, Algebra, Calculus, or Chemistry outside of the academic school year.

How long are the sessions?

All appointments last an hour. Tutoring is one-on-one and in-person in Whitefish Bay in the Fox Bay Theater/ Argo Building.

Is tutoring in-person? Do you do virtual sessions?

All tutoring is in-person and one-on-one in my Whitefish Bay office.

How often should students meet?

Consistency is paramount, such that weekly meetings are a must. My Whitefish Bay tutoring office is conveniently located for students of Milwaukee’s North Shore

What subjects do you tutor?

Core subjects are math, science, and the ACT. Math tutoring is algebra through calculus (including AP courses) , while science is Physics, Chemistry, and AP Chemistry. Over decades, I have become familiar with these courses, as well as some of the idiosyncrasies of certain schools nearby like Nicolet, Homestead, Shorewood, Whitefish Bay, and private schools like Marquette High School, DSHA, University School of Milwaukee, and Dominican High School.

Can students be tutored on only one or two subjects of the ACT?

While I prefer to tutor all four sections of the ACT to maximize scores, there are rare occasions where tutoring only one or two ACT subjects can be effective.

How do I pay for tutoring?

Payment for tutoring is expected at the time of the appointment and can be made via check, cash, or credit card.
